CRS08
TOSHIBA Schottky Barrier Rectifier Schottky Barrier Type
CRS08
Switching Mode Power Supply Applications
Unit: mm
Portable Equipment Battery Applications
Forward voltage: VFM = 0.36 V (max) Average forward current: IF (AV) = 1.5 A Repetitive peak reverse voltage: VRRM = 30 V Suitable for compact assembly due to small surface-mount package “S−FLATTM” (Toshiba package name)

Frequently Asked Questions
What precautions must be taken when handling Schottky barrier diodes?
Be aware of large reverse current leakage; improper operation can cause thermal runaway, so consider forward and reverse loss during design.
What is the maximum repetitive peak reverse voltage (RRM) rating for this device?
The repetitive peak reverse voltage (V_RRM) rating is 30 V.
Are these diodes suitable for mission-critical systems like medical or aerospace equipment?
No. They are intended for general electronics applications and are not warranted for use in equipment requiring extraordinarily high quality or reliability, such as medical instruments.
